PNPM makes you approve postinstall scripts instead of running them by default, which helps a lot. Whenever I see a prompt to run a postinstall script, unless I know the package normally has one & what it does, I go look it up before approving it.

(Of course I could still get bitten if one of the packages I trust has its postinstall script replaced.)
